What Are APIs?
APIs are sets of rules and protocols that allow one piece of software to interact with another. They define the methods and data formats that applications can use to communicate with each other. For example, a weather application on your smartphone uses APIs to retrieve weather data from a remote server. APIs can be used in numerous scenarios, including web services, operating systems, database systems, and so forth.
Types of APIs
There are several types of APIs, broadly categorized into the following groups: - Open APIs (also known as External or Public APIs): These APIs are publicly available to developers and third-party applications. They enhance the functionality of systems by allowing new applications to interact freely. - Partner APIs: These APIs are technically similar to open APIs but are intended for a specific purpose or partnership. They are shared with specific partners through a third-party gateway. - Internal APIs (or Private APIs): Used within an organization, these APIs are designed to enhance collaboration and efficiency among different internal systems. - Composite APIs: These allow fetching data from multiple endpoints in one call, simplifying interactions and reducing the number of requests needed.
Benefits of APIs
APIs come with a multitude of advantages, which can be categorized as follows:
1. Efficiency and Speed
APIs streamline processes by allowing applications to communicate without human intervention, significantly reducing the time taken to perform tasks. Developers can utilize existing APIs to avoid reinventing the wheel, thus speeding up the development process.
2. Scalability
APIs enable systems to scale efficiently. As demand increases, applications can use APIs to add new features or services without overhauling existing infrastructure. This is instrumental for businesses looking to grow and adapt to market changes quickly.
3. Integration
APIs enable different applications and systems to work together, facilitating seamless integration. For instance, an AI model can be integrated with a data analysis tool through APIs, allowing for advanced analytics to be performed on real-time data.
4. Cost-Effectiveness
By using APIs, businesses can minimize costs associated with development. Instead of building features from scratch, companies can leverage existing APIs, allowing them to focus on core business logic.
5. Security
Well-designed APIs can enhance security by allowing limited access to certain data. They can be configured to authenticate users, ensuring that only authorized individuals can access sensitive information.
6. Controlled Access
API gateways can control traffic and enforce policies such as quotas and throtling, which helps in managing resources effectively and preventing misuse.
7. Standardization
APIs provide standardized methods for communicating, making development easier and more consistent. This is particularly evident when working with various AI models, where standard request formats can greatly simplify interactions.

API Gateway: A Crucial Component
An API Gateway is an essential component of API management that acts as a single entry point for all API calls. It facilitates and manages the communication between clients and services. Here are some key functionalities of API gateways:
1. Request Routing
API gateways ensure that requests are directed to the appropriate backend service after verifying the incoming request.
2. Protocol Translation
They can translate between different protocols (e.g., transforming an HTTP request into a message that a backend system can utilize).
3. Security
API gateways serve as a protective layer, managing API authentication and authorization. This is crucial for preventing unauthorized access to services.
4. Traffic Management
These gateways can regulate how requests and responses are handled, ensuring optimal traffic routing and load management.
5. Analytics and Monitoring
API gateways often come with built-in analytics tools that provide insights into traffic patterns and user interactions with APIs. This data can guide future optimizations and improvements.
API Governance
API governance refers to the processes and policies that ensure APIs are managed effectively throughout their lifecycle. Proper API governance helps organizations safeguard their API assets while aligning them with business objectives.
Why Is API Governance Important?
- Consistency and Standardization: Ensures all APIs follow the same design principles, methodologies, and security practices.
- Compliance: Helps organizations comply with regulatory requirements and internal policies, particularly around data privacy.
- Quality Control: Maintains a consistent API quality, reducing potential bugs and enhancing the user experience.
- Monitoring and Metrics: Offers insights into API usage, allowing organizations to make informed decisions based on performance data.
Challenges With API Governance
Implementing proper API governance can pose some challenges, like resource allocation, the need for continuous monitoring, and the complexity of managing numerous APIs in large organizations.
